Beginning in a small seven hundred square foot building in Bethlehem, Connecticut, High-Lites grew rapidly; a result of the expertise and reputation of the partners in the emergency light field, and an employee recruitment process that emphasized professionalism and a customer-oriented, "Can Do" spirit. Within two years, the company boasted a ten-thousand square foot address in Waterbury, Connecticut and a reputation for quality and innovation with emergency light products. In July of 1989, Jac Jacobsen Industries purchased High-Lites from its shareholders and made it part of the JJI Lighting Group family, a group of fifteen distinct companies specializing in a wide variety of emergency lighting products for a range of personal and professional environments. Under the guidance of JJI, High-Lites has continued its growth and in 1993, added four thousand square feet of both office and manufacturing space. Today, High-Lites is a $5 million company, employing twenty-two full-time employees, including both office and manufacturing personnel. The company also has a sales force of fifty-four agents, and JJI RVPs (Regional Vice Presidents) that have enabled us to become a widely recognized name in the emergency lighting field. |
